Abstract
The utility model discloses a lamps and lanterns convenient to assembly, include lamp shade, radiator and be used for non -light tight face lid, the radiator is located the lamp shade reaches between the face lid, the radiator is equipped with a plurality of through -holes, still includes assembly devices, assembly devices includes first subassembly and second subassembly, first subassembly includes the fixed plate, the fixed plate is located the lamp shade is inboard, the fixed plate top is equipped with the draw -in groove, the second subassembly is including being down unciform checkpost, the checkpost is located the edge of face lid, the fixed plate passes the through -hole, the checkpost block in on the draw -in groove, and then will the radiator is fixed in the lamp shade reaches between the face lid. The utility model discloses simplify the assembly methods of prior art lamps and lanterns, reduced the size control point, improved production efficiency, reduced manufacturing cost.

Detailed description of the invention
Below in conjunction with the drawings and the specific embodiments, the utility model is described in further detail.
As shown in Figures 1 to 5, the utility model discloses a kind of light fixture being convenient to assemble, comprise lampshade 1, radiator 2 and the cover 3 for printing opacity, described radiator 2 is located between described lampshade 1 and described cover 3, described radiator 2 is provided with some through holes 21, also comprise assemble mechanism 4, described assemble mechanism 4 comprises the first assembly 41 and the second assembly 42, described first assembly 41 is located on described lampshade 1, described second assembly 42 is located on described cover 3, and described first assembly 41 and described second assembly 42 are cooperatively interacted by described through hole 21.
As the preferred embodiment of embodiment, as shown in Figures 1 and 2, described first assembly 41 comprises fixed head 411, it is inboard that described lampshade 1 is located at by described fixed head 411, draw-in groove 412 is provided with above described fixed head 411, described second assembly 42 comprises in barb-like clamp 421, as shown in Figure 4, the edge of described cover 3 is located at by described clamp 421, described fixed head 411 is through described through hole 21, described clamp 421 is sticked on described draw-in groove 412, and then is fixed between described lampshade 1 and described cover 3 by described radiator 2.
Certainly, first assembly of described assemble mechanism and the specific constructive form of the second assembly can be exchanged, such as, described first assembly comprises in barb-like clamp, and the inboard of described lampshade is located at by described clamp, described second assembly comprises fixed head, described cover edge is located at by described fixed head, is provided with draw-in groove above described fixed head, and described fixed head is through described through hole, described clamp is sticked on described draw-in groove, and then is fixed between described lampshade and described cover by described radiator.
As shown in Figure 3, as the preferred embodiment of embodiment, described radiator 2 is also provided with extension 21, and described extension 21 is located at the neighboring of described radiator 2, it is outside that described extension 21 is exposed to described lampshade 1, is provided with annular groove 22 between described extension 21 and described lampshade 1 outer wall.Radiator body is directly extended to outside by the utility model, and forming section heat sink body is exposed, and heat generating components (light source) is on a heat sink fastening, and heat more promptly can be conducted to external environment condition by such radiator fast, makes heat radiation more abundant.
As the preferred embodiment of embodiment, described fixed head 411 also comprises reinforcement 413, and some described reinforcements 413 are located on described fixed head 411.
As the preferred embodiment of embodiment, described lampshade 1 is provided with the first accommodating cavity 11 for accommodating driving power 5, and described radiator 2 is provided with the second accommodating cavity 22 for accommodating light source 6, and described driving power 5 is electrically connected with described light source 6.
As the preferred embodiment of embodiment, described driving power 5 adopts low-voltage dc power supply, prevents electric shock risk.
As shown in Figure 5, as the preferred embodiment of embodiment, described cover 3 adopts Fresnel lens structure, namely described cover 3 one side is light face, the ascending concentric circles of another side imprinting.
As the preferred embodiment of embodiment, described in draw together assemble mechanism 4 quantity be 4-8.Preferably, 6 described assemble mechanisms are adopted to be evenly distributed on lamp interior.
As the preferred embodiment of embodiment, the material that described lampshade 1 adopts is plastics.
When using the utility model structure, by fixed head of the present utility model through after the through hole of radiator, draw-in groove on fixed head is directly fastened on clamp, namely the assembling of light fixture is completed, simplify the assembling mode that prior art need be assembled layer by layer, meanwhile, the utility model arranges the extension being directly exposed to light fixture outside on radiator body, radiating effect of the present utility model is promoted greatly, and then extends service life of the present utility model.
In a word, the utility model has the following advantages: 1, parts are few, and structure is simple; 2, this structure can make lamp installation step simplify, and is more conducive to optimization technological process; 3, the assembling position of lamp housing is reduced, and decreases fitted position requirement, makes more compact structure, more tends to integration, can reduce assembly cost; 4, radiator extends to outside, makes radiating effect more remarkable; 5, radiator is made of one structure, can keep the rigidity of extension, and assembling light fixture is not easily out of shape.
